1. Boiling under water: it is generally agreed that porridge is boiled in cold water, but the real expert is to cook porridge with boiling water. Why? You must have experience of boiling congee in cold water, right? Boiling underwater pot will not have this phenomenon, and it is more time-saving than cold water porridge.

2. Soaking: soak the rice in cold water for half an hour before cooking porridge, and let the rice expand. The advantages of doing this: A, cooking porridge to save time; B, stirring will be along a direction; C, cooked porridge crisp, taste good.

3. Mixing: it turns out that the reason why we cook porridge occasionally is that we are afraid of the bottom of the porridge paste. Now there is no worry about boiling the bottom of the porridge with cold water. Why stir it? In order to make the rice grains full and crisp. The mixing technique is: stir a few times when boiling water, cover the pot until simmer for 20 minutes, start stirring continuously, and continue for about 10 minutes until it is crisp and thick.

4. Heat: first boil with high heat, and then turn to low heat to boil for about 30 minutes. Don't underestimate the size of the fire conversion, porridge flavor from this!

5. Separate cooking: most people are used to pouring all the things into the pot when they are cooking porridge, but the century old porridge shop does not. The bottom of porridge is the bottom of porridge, and the material is the material. It is boiled separately, and then boiled for a while, and no more than 10 minutes. The porridge made in this way is fresh and not turbid, and the taste of everything is boiled out without string flavor. Especially when the auxiliary materials are meat and seafood, the bottom of porridge should be separated from the auxiliary materials.

6. Oil: do you need oil to cook porridge? Yes, add a little salad oil about 10 minutes after the porridge is changed to a mild fire. You will find that the finished porridge is not only bright in color, but also fresh and smooth in the mouth.
